summaryrefslogtreecommitdiff
path: root/source3
AgeCommit message (Collapse)AuthorFilesLines
2010-05-25s3:registry: use regval_ctr/blob accessor functoin in reg_eventlog.cMichael Adam1-7/+13
2010-05-25s3:registry: user regval_ctr/blob accessor functions in reg_backend_db.cMichael Adam1-10/+10
2010-05-25s3:registry: use regval_ctr/blob accessor functions in reg_api.cMichael Adam1-33/+38
2010-05-25s3:registry:reg_objects: add regval_ctr_set_seqnum()Michael Adam2-0/+12
2010-05-25s3:registry:reg_objects: add regval_ctr_get_seqnum()Michael Adam2-0/+10
2010-05-25s3:registry:reg_objects: add regval_ctr_init()Michael Adam2-0/+18
2010-05-25s3:registry: move definition of registry_hook to reg_init_full.c - it's only ↵Michael Adam2-5/+5
user
2010-05-25s3:registry: extract registry_pull/push_value prototypes into own headerMichael Adam6-10/+36
reg_util_marshalling.h and use them only where needed.
2010-05-25s3:registry: rename lib/util_reg_api.c to registry/reg_util_marshalling.cMichael Adam2-2/+3
2010-05-25s3:registry: rename reg_util.{c,h} to reg_util_internal.{c,h}Michael Adam8-7/+7
2010-05-25s3:registry: move prototype registry_create_admin_token() to new header ↵Michael Adam5-2/+29
reg_util_token.h and use it only where necessary.
2010-05-25s3:registry: move registry_create_admin_token() to new reg_util_token.cMichael Adam3-38/+59
2010-05-25s3:registry: extract reg_eventlog prototypes to header of their ownMichael Adam5-6/+32
and use them only where needed.
2010-05-25s3:registry: extract reg_perfcount prototypes into header of their own.Michael Adam7-10/+38
And use them only when necessary.
2010-05-25s3:registry: extraxt the reg_dispatcher prototypes into their own header.Michael Adam5-22/+47
And use them only where needed.
2010-05-25s3:registry: extract the reg_backend_db prototypes into their own header.Michael Adam12-18/+51
And use them only where needed.
2010-05-25s3:registry: adapt callers of regval_ctr_addvalue to uint8 * instead of char *Michael Adam11-49/+49
2010-05-25s3:registry: fix regval_ctr_addvalue() to take data as uint8 *, not char *.Michael Adam2-5/+5
2010-05-25s3:registry: fix data_p arg of regval_compose to be uint8 * instead of char *Michael Adam2-2/+2
2010-05-25s3:registry: extract the reg_util prototypes into their own header.Michael Adam8-8/+35
And use them only where needed.
2010-05-25s3:registry: remove superfluous comments from registry.hMichael Adam1-28/+0
2010-05-25s3:registry: extract the reg_util_legacy prototypes into their own header.Michael Adam4-8/+47
And use them only where necessary.
2010-05-25s3:registry: extract the reg_cachehook prototypes into their own header.Michael Adam7-8/+34
And use them only where necessary.
2010-05-25s3:registry: protect registry.h from multiple inclusionMichael Adam1-0/+4
2010-05-25s3:registry: add C to reg_cachehook, confessing considerable changes in 2008Michael Adam1-0/+1
2010-05-25s3:fix configure after change "add Werror_FLAGS for IBM's xlc"Michael Adam1-0/+1
For me, 24b3725407f1a67e13a7646d2e3f26ed1e4735ff broke configure. The fix in f634450b67d2a084c41a63c0e94eb47adb90e101 is not complete yet. After staring at the change a bit, tt seems to me that the code inserted was just misplaced by one line. Michael
2010-05-25s3: fix the configure runBjörn Jacke1-1/+0
2010-05-24s3:configure: turn "error warnings" into errorsBjörn Jacke1-1/+1
By default "Missing argument(s)" is just an "error warning" for xlc :-) The change to turn "error warnings" into errors should fix bug #7427.
2010-05-24s3:configure: add Werror_FLAGS for IBM's xlcBjörn Jacke1-2/+14
2010-05-24s3: major overhaul of compiler and linker flags for HP-UX buildsBjörn Jacke1-9/+27
this will fix a number of things like shared library builds. That in turn will probably trigger some other build bugs...
2010-05-24s3:Makefile: set PIE flags also for nss_winbindBjörn Jacke1-1/+1
2010-05-24s3:build: remove CFLAGS from LDSHFLAGS, SHLD has them alreadyBjörn Jacke1-4/+1
2010-05-24s3:Makefile: position independency is also needed for shared libsBjörn Jacke1-2/+2
2010-05-24s3:build: don't use pieflags twice - ldflags already have themBjörn Jacke1-2/+2
2010-05-23s3: Another non-gnumake fixVolker Lendecke1-6/+7
AC_OUTPUT_COMMANDS must be called before AC_OUTPUT and $MAKEFILE is not defined in ./config.status
2010-05-23s3: Factor out compiler-independent definesVolker Lendecke1-1/+3
2010-05-23s3: Next step to fix the build on OpenSolarisVolker Lendecke1-0/+1
2010-05-22s3: Attempt to fix the non-gnumake buildVolker Lendecke1-1/+2
Björn, please check!
2010-05-22s3: Remove unreachable codeVolker Lendecke1-1/+0
2010-05-21If using fake oplocks, use the correct SMB2 type code for "no oplock".Jeremy Allison1-1/+1
Jeremy.
2010-05-21Don't forget brackets around bitwise tests.Jeremy Allison1-1/+1
Jeremy.
2010-05-21Make DFS work over SMB2.Jeremy Allison5-17/+49
Jeremy.
2010-05-21Fix bug #7448 - smbd crash when sambaLMPassword and sambaNTPassword entries ↵Roel van Meer1-0/+3
missing from ldap. Protect SMBsesskeygen_ntv1() from a NULL pointer.
2010-05-21Make krb5 over SMB2 identical to the way we handle it in SMB1.Jeremy Allison1-2/+50
Jeremy.
2010-05-21Set SMB2 max read/write/trans sizes to Win7 compatible - 1Mb.Jeremy Allison1-3/+3
Jeremy.
2010-05-21s3: added support for fake oplocks in SMB2.Ira Cooper1-2/+14
2010-05-21s3-net: fix net_ads_gpo() for non-ads case.Günther Deschner1-1/+1
Guenther
2010-05-21s3:dom_sid Global replace of DOM_SID with struct dom_sidAndrew Bartlett120-1284/+1277
This matches the structure that new code is being written to, and removes one more of the old-style named structures, and the need to know that is is just an alias for struct dom_sid. Andrew Bartlett Signed-off-by: Günther Deschner <gd@samba.org>
2010-05-21s3:passdb Remove use of uint8 uint16 and uint32 in favour of C99 typesAndrew Bartlett9-324/+324
Signed-off-by: Günther Deschner <gd@samba.org>
2010-05-21s3: registry: add tests with empty valuenameGregor Beck1-13/+25
Signed-off-by: Michael Adam <obnox@samba.org>